Transaction 20a20e596ca8426ca175b5e4a4a92dd82f7dc6c6bcf5f89d2cdef44c5a43651c
1 Input
2 Outputs
- 20a20e596ca8426ca175b5e4a4a92dd82f7dc6c6bcf5f89d2cdef44c5a43651c:0
- 20a20e596ca8426ca175b5e4a4a92dd82f7dc6c6bcf5f89d2cdef44c5a43651c:1
value 6789
address 3Fx8Wj6ziFPrMKWaa8EpvUFPAkpeHT6afH
value 627785742
address 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w